The role of physiotherapy in concussion treatment and management

Physiotherapists can be an integral part of the concussion recovery process. Assessment includes a battery of tests to address the potential causes of symptoms (both acute and chronic), which may be present following concussion. These include assessment and treatment of the:

  • Visual system
  • Vestibular system
  • Cervical spine (neck) joints and musculature
  • Cardiovascular system

Education and advice regarding:

  • Return to activity and return to sport
  • Diet
  • Supplements
  • The nature and mechanism of concussion
  • Up to date research

All of the above are very important components of the concussion treatment which is provided.

When should I see a physiotherapist about concussion treatment and management?

Within 24-48hrs following injury. Often it can take up to a week to get in to see your GP following injury, and research supports seeing your concussion trained health professional as soon as possible, to help both minimise and reduce your symptom severity. Your health professional will also be able to direct you if you need more urgent follow up in the hospital for scans or direct you to specialists if it is deemed appropriate.

What is multimodal baseline testing?

Multimodal baseline testing is a series of physical and cognitive tests that provides a pre-injury overview of healthy brain function. These tests can offer healthcare practitioners with an objective benchmark on which to compare should a patient sustain a concussion. As concussion symptoms often disappear days to weeks before the brain has recovered, having valuable baseline information may help practitioners to make safer return to play decisions.

What is Concussion Baseline Testing?

Baseline Concussion testing is a crucial pre-injury assessment tool for athletes, evaluating their cognitive abilities and other neurological functions. This assessment, conducted before any potential head trauma, establishes a benchmark for comparison in the event of a concussion. It assists medical professionals such as athletic trainers, physiotherapists, and chiropractors in accurately diagnosing concussions and helping with concussion management.

By tracking changes from the baseline, healthcare providers can make informed decisions regarding an athlete’s safe return to play, ensuring their overall well-being and reducing the risk of long-term consequences associated with repeated head injuries.

Why Athletes Should Have Baseline Concussion Testing.

Individualized Baseline Information:

Provides a personalized baseline for each athlete before any head injury occurs.

Aids in Concussion Diagnosis:

Offers a point of comparison to assess a concussion by comparing post-injury concussion test results with the baseline, helping in a more accurate diagnosis.

Objective Evaluation:

Offers objective data for medical professionals to measure the extent of impairment caused by a concussion, allowing for better treatment.

Safer Return to Play Decisions:

Guides the gradual return-to-play process by tracking recovery progress against the baseline, reducing the risk of premature return to activity.

Concussion Education and Awareness Tool:

Raises awareness about the seriousness of concussions and encourages proactive measures among athletes, coaches, parents, and sports organizations.

These benefits collectively contribute to a more comprehensive concussion care and management approach.
